Good Q1 for Goodyear

April 29, 2010 - After a miserable Q1 in 2009, Goodyear Tire & Rubber bounced back in the first quarter of 2010.
Goodyear saw a net loss of $47 million ($0.19 per share), which included a $99 million charge related to the devaluation of Venezuela’s currency. However, the loss was significantly lower than Q1 2009 [...]

Plastics Propel Bayer in Q1

April 29, 2010 - A continued recovery in its plastics and foams unit helps Bayer AG offset lower demand for its pesticides and allows the company to up its 2010 outlook.
The German pharmaceutical giant predicts that its 2010 operating profit will now exceed 7 billion euro. The company previously predicted its profit would fall short [...]

Report: FedEx, Port Authority Reach Lease Agreement

April 29, 2010 - FedEx and the Port Authority of NY and NJ have reached an agreement that will keep the shipping giant at Newark’s Liberty Airport until at least 2030, according to the Newark Star-Ledger.
The deal is worth $352 million over the life of the lease, with FedEx responsible for making $30 million of [...]

PotashCorp Earnings Skyrocket

April 29, 2010 - Canadian mineral and mining company PotashCorp reported its second-highest Q1 earnings in company history, with earnings of $1.47 per share — a 46% increase over Q1 2009.
Sales of potash spiked as fertilizer demand fizzled, and the nutrient was responsible for generating 72% of PotashCorp’s Q1 gross margin of $715.1 million.
